None of the "fun" censors were changed.

 

The point of a censor is not really that you're supposed to be able to use offensive words - just in transferred versions. Cabbage now has a transferred meaning on Tip.It, which is okay. But some more offensive words just should never have that, and you aren't supposed to be able to guess every filtered word from what they are censored to. If that was the case, we might aswell just have dropped the censor in the first place - as people would have used those word as insults instead. In fact, that has even happened with "cabbage" and "gardening tool" already. :unsure:

When everybody knows the meaning of the replacement word, it loses its censoring effect.
